ABSTRACT

BACKGROUND: The case of a 32-year-old Malay woman who developed postpartum stroke is reported. METHODS: The patient received a series of urut Melayu, the traditional Malay massage, sessions at one of the newly established integrated hospitals in the country. RESULTS: After 14 urut Melayu sessions, she improved tremendously in her speech and fine motor skills and regained her activities of daily living. CONCLUSIONS: This use of urut Melayu to complement rehabilitation care in patients poststroke is promising.
